Qualifying off to fast start

Qualifying got off to a fast start Wednesday with 12 local candidates paying fees by 4 p.m. Most were candidates or incumbents who had previously announced but one county commissioner drew unannounced competition. John Samek qualified to run against incumbent county commissioner Nancy Thrash, who also qualified, in district four. The district three county commission race has three qualifiers thus far in Van Baker, Kelvin Chute and Julia Heidbrink. Brad White qualified to run for sheriff. The remainder of the qualifiers were incumbents including: Tax commissioner Andrea Anthony. District 3 school board member Susan Byars. Chief magistrate William Thomas. District 1 school board member Horace Hightower. Clerk of court Frank Abbott. Probate judge Kathy Martin. In state and district races, qualifiers included: Incumbent district 16 state senator Ronnie Chance. Incumbent district 130 state representative David Knight. Incumbent district 140 stat representative Robert Dickey. As announced, Ryan Christopher has qualified to seek the district 131 seat in the state house being vacated by Billy Maddox. Incumbent Towaliga Circuit superior court judge Bill Fears has qualified for reelection. Towaliga Circuit district attorney Richard Milam has also qualified for reelection. Incumbent District 3 U.S. Representative Lynn Westmoreland has qualified.
